  • I can't open a file in OS 922 that was created in OS X.

    The web-pages I downloaded while in OS X (and stored in the HD) appear blank, (white, no logo) when I am booted in OS 922. When I try to open them, I receive a message "Sorry, could not open because the application that created it could not be found".
    So OS 922 cannot find an application (in this case do they mean Safari or OSX ?) that created the file. Sounds logical since OS X didn't exist when OS 922 was created. And Safari neither I think (if that plays any role)
    Question: does the Internet connection (Internet Explorer vs. Safari play any role ?)
    I have no problem whatsoever with files downloaded with Internet Explorer (5.1.6 or previous versions I had). Or from OS 9.0.4 to 9.2.2.
    Nor do I with photos (even with Safari and OS X) .
    Only web-pages and documents (including TextEdit) done with OS X. And not all files but half of them.
    G4   Mac OS X (10.4.7)  

    Hi, I need -
    OS 9's Finder uses File Type and Creator codes embedded in files to determine how the file should be handled - what program to use to open it, and how that program should process the file.
    OSX uses filename extensions rather than File Type and Creator codes.
    As a result, it is not uncommon for a file created in an OSX environment to be displayed as a generic unknown-type document when the machine is booted to OS 9; and for Finder to not know how to handle it when it is double-clicked.
    If you know that a certain program in OS 9 should be able to open a file, try dropping that file onto the icon for that program (or on an alias to that program) - some programs are capable of trying to open a file done that way; others won't even try.
    In most cases, a file created by an OSX app will not be openable by an OS 9 app - this is understandable, given that newer programs often use more advanced formats than older ones, even versions of the same program.
    If you know that you will be transporting a file from OSX to OS 9, try saving it in a form accessible by OS 9 - many programs will offer a list of alternate file formats when you do a Save As of the file, or (in some cases) an Export of it.
    Question: does the Internet connection (Internet Explorer vs. Safari play any role ?)
    It certainly can. If Safari saves a file in a proprietary format, then IE will probably not be able to open it. However, a file saved in plain html should be openable by most any browser.
    You might experiment with the settings in OS 9's File Exchange control panel, particularly the ones listed under PC Exchange. Adjusting some of these, or creating new linkages, may allow OS 9 to handle files which are openable by your OS 9 programs, but which are not identifiable by Finder.

  • Open/fill in form on Mac that was created in Windows?  What Mac software needed?

    Created a form in Windows using Acrobat Pro 9/LiveCycle Designer. Need to send this form to Mac user to fill out.  He can't add info to form or see check boxes.  What software does he need on Mac?  Once he completes form will email data back to me to import to form, then I need to email completed form to him to open on his iPad, read & sign.  What software does he need on iPad to open/see/sign form?  He has the program that allows him to "overlay" and save signature.

    I'm not aware of any software that allows XFA forms created with LiveCycle Designer to work with iOS. If you want PDF forms that will work on iOS you shold create them in Acrobat. These are known a Acroforms. Adobe Reader for iOS can then be used to work with the forms, but Readdle's PDF Expert has the most complete support for forms and JavaScript.

  • After upgrading from acrobat 9.5 to XI pro my users have complained on slow typing when filling in form that were created in version 9.5?

    After upgrading from acrobat 9.5 to XI pro my users have complained on slow typing when filling in form that were created in version 9.5?
    The issue is they type but there is 2 second delay when it appears in the field.
    Windows 7 64bit

    I see, I misread your reference to Reader 11 to mean you were using Acrobat 11, but it looks like it worked out anyway.
    The base-14 fonts are special in PDF because they are guaranteed to be available even if they are not embedded. If you select a non-base-14 font for use with a form field, the entire font usually gets embedded, since each glyph it contains has to be available for use with the field. This can take up a lot of space if you do this a lot, and the space isn't reduced if you change back to a base-14 font later because the internal reference to it is not removed. This is caused by the bug I mentioned.
    In your case, however, the entire font doesn't get embedded because fonts like it (e.g., large asian fonts with a lot of glyphs, Arial Unicode) would take up too much space if fully embedded. If it did, a 100KB PDF could bloat to 20MB with that one change. Instead, users are expected to have such fonts installed on their system, which is why you were prompted to install the font pack. This despite the fact that the font was not actually used by anything in your document, it was simply the orphaned reference to it that triggered this. This should get fixed in Acrobat eventually so this type of thing doesn't happen again.

  • I'm worried about what will happen if I delete my recent backup data from the phone I still own? Will I lose any progress in games that was saved in the backup?

    I'm worried about what will happen if I delete my recent backup data from the phone I still own? Will I lose any progress in games that was saved in the backup?
    I have an iPhone 4S and I keep getting those irritating notifications that tell me I need to upgrade my storage or free up space. I've deleted all I can from my music and photos without losing too many precious memories, but it's come to the point where I think I need to delete backups. However, I'm just worried that I will lose all and any log-in information that I don't remember and app/game progress that was saved to the iCloud. Please Tell me what will happen/what I can do?

    If you are asking what happens when you delete an iCloud backup, it only deletes the backup from your account.  It won't do anything to the data on your phone or in your iCloud account.  If you don't need to backup you can delete it.  (If you no longer want to back up your phone to iCloud, turn iCloud backup off in Settings>iCloud>Backup.  Then your phone will back up to your computer each time you sync it with iTunes.)
